Well, given it was my first triathlon (and racing in the clydesdales), I was pretty happy with the results.  However, I had a few rookie errors that certainly slowed me down, such as leaving my water bottle in the car (no water the entire race until mile 1 of the run!) and smushing my gel out on my handlebars as I embarked on the bike.  Furthermore, I certainly need to get some aero-bars for my bike before the next race. 

As you can tell by my results, I am a far superior swimmer to the other legs; however, as I was standing around looking for instructions for the start the horn blew and there I was standing around 30yds behind the lead swimmers as they took off.  So, I know I coule of went an easy 30 seconds faster than that, if not quite a bit more.
